Pippa Dog and Mistress; Mati here. First, HaRoouuu ;-) PippaBoy! Ok, back to the comments - Mistress is right! Too much exercise can lead to arthritis as my doctor said to my Dad. The exercise doesn't seem like hard work, but I can tell Rocky is getting more tired now. But I go with him, ---of course. Rocky told me that the under water tread mill is good because it's good exercise with resistance - but it is controlled with a controlled speed. Too much exercise will just make things worse as Mistress said. The exercise doesn't fix the hip problem, but it does help build up the muscle mass around the leg and hip area and will make it easier for him to walk and move his legs. The doctor said he's starting to use his back to help swing the legs which is bad. This will lead to more problems. The hip socket is mostly gone, but the muscles are holding the leg/hip in place. At this point poor Rocky has been using his rear legs as little as possible and therefore the muscle mass has deteriorated. So he needs to pump that iron ----err, water- I mean!
